East Midlands Railway urges essential travel only

East Midlands Railway is advising customers to travel only if essential for the rest of the week, as high temperatures are expected to impact rail services across the region.

The UK Health and Security Agency has issued an amber heat-health alert covering the East Midlands and five other regions of England from today (Wednesday 8th July) until Sunday 12th July 2026. In response, EMR is introducing temporary timetable changes to help maintain safe and reliable services.

Passengers who need to travel are strongly encouraged to do so before 12 noon, when temperatures are expected to be lower. Customers should also check the latest travel information before leaving home, as delays, longer journey times and short-notice alterations are possible.

As part of the temporary timetable, some intercity services will be reduced. In addition, regional services between Nottingham and Worksop, and Nottingham and Leicester, will be suspended from 12 noon to help maintain fleet availability across the wider network.

EMR says the changes are necessary because extreme temperatures can affect railway infrastructure and require trains to operate at reduced speeds in some areas to ensure safe operation.

The operator is working closely with Network Rail to monitor conditions throughout the week. Customers are also advised to carry drinking water, wear lightweight clothing and make use of shaded areas or station waiting rooms where available.

Philippa Cresswell, Customer Experience Director at East Midlands Railway, said:

"The hot weather means we'll need to make some temporary changes to our services to keep the railway operating safely.

"If you do need to travel and the journey is essential, we'd recommend travelling before midday and checking your journey before setting off.

"We appreciate these changes may inconvenience some customers and we'd like to thank everyone for their patience and understanding while we work to keep people moving safely."
